How to calculate the skirting area
In home decoration, the installation of baseboards is an essential part. Not only does it protect the wall from kicks, but it also serves as a decoration. However, many people often don’t know how to calculate the required area when purchasing skirting boards. 1. The function of skirting line

The main functions of baseboards include:
1.protect wall: Prevent water stains or stains from contaminating the wall when mopping or sweeping the floor.
2.decorative effect: Improve the aesthetics of the overall decoration.
3.hide gaps: Cover expansion joints between floors or tiles and walls.
2. Calculation method of baseboard area
The calculation of the baseboard area mainly involves two factors:lengthandheight. The specific steps are as follows:
1.Measure room perimeter: Use a tape measure to measure the total length of the wall where baseboards need to be installed (unit: meters).
2.Determine the baseboard height: Common skirting line heights are 8cm, 10cm, 12cm, etc. (unit: centimeters).
3.Calculate the area of a single skirting board: Area of baseboard = length × height. For example, the area of a skirting board that is 2 meters long and 10cm high is: 2m × 0.1m = 0.2㎡.
4.Calculate total required area: Based on the total perimeter of the room and the length of a single skirting board, calculate the total number of skirting boards required and the total area.
To facilitate understanding, the following are examples of area calculations for several common skirting specifications:
| Baseboard length (meters) | Baseboard height (cm) | Single block area (square meters) |
|---|---|---|
| 2 | 8 | 0.16 |
| 2.5 | 10 | 0.25 |
| 3 | 12 | 0.36 |
3. Actual case analysis
Assume that the perimeter of a room is 20 meters, choose a skirting line with a height of 10cm, and a single length of 2.5 meters. The calculation steps are as follows:
1.total number of blocks: 20 meters ÷ 2.5 meters/block = 8 blocks.
2.total area: 8 blocks × 0.25㎡/block = 2㎡.
4. Precautions
1.reserve loss: It is recommended to purchase 5%-10% more baseboards to deal with cutting loss or installation errors.
2.Material selection: The prices and installation methods of skirting boards made of different materials (such as wood, PVC, metal) are different and need to be confirmed in advance.
3.Corner treatment: The baseboards need to be cut and spliced at the corners. It is recommended that professionals do this.
5. Popular baseboard materials and price reference
The following are the common baseboard materials and price ranges on the market recently:
| Material | Price range (yuan/meter) | Features |
|---|---|---|
| PVC | 5-15 | Waterproof and economical |
| wooden | 20-50 | Beautiful and good texture |
| Aluminum alloy | 30-80 | Durable and modern |
